Smile Hey there from Australia(Actually a Kiwi though)

Hi there to all the fellow guitar players!
Watching the PicknGrin videos over at ultimate-guitar.com and he made reference to this site so I'd thought id check it out, and its awesome to see so many like-minded people sharing all their advice, and just chatting about guitar!!
Anyways, i started playing when I was 13 (im 24 now) and played for 3 years, but then when hitting scales and all that scary stuff i sort of put the guitar down and didnt pick it back up. (And maybe the fact the girls and video games kinda come along) But last March when I went back to New Zealand for a holiday I saw the old Ibanez electric sitting gathering dust so I sent it over and thought Id get back into it, the Electric wasnt really my style so I bought a basic $200 acoustic (Which i still use at the beach and take to work) and hit the guitar bigtime. 10 months on, have upgraded to a Maton em225c Acoustic/Electric which is an awesome guitar. Practise everyday and am trying to focus on acoustic blues and fingerstlyle guitar.
My main influences are David Gilmour(Pink Floyd), Lindsay Buckingham(Fleetwood Mac) Mark Knopfler (Dire Straits) and Tommy Emmanuel. Love kicking back with a few beers and mates and having everyone sing away with me and I belt out some classic tunes!!
Anyways, thats enough rambling from me, take it easy everybody!
